Boyd jumps her way to another NAIA All-American honor Wednesday evening

MARION, IN – Alexia Boyd earned her second NAIA All-American of her career Wednesday evening in the long jump to complete day one at the NAIA Outdoor Track & Field Championships.
 
Boyd hit her best jump on her final attempt of the preliminary round. Boyd was able to hit a mark of 5.70m, just .03m off tying for fourth place overall. Alexia Schofield was unable to qualify for the final in the long jump. Schofield ran the 200m prelims 30 minutes before the long jump. She placed 14th in the event running a time of 24.18.
 
In the 4x100m relay, Boyd, Schofield, Kourtlyn Cannon, and LaAuhnni Lewis placed in the top ten in the event. They placed second in heat three with time of 46.59, less than .17 seconds away from qualifying for the finals. 
 
Campbellsville will return to the track on Thursday afternoon when the women compete in the 4x400m relay preliminary round and the triple jump. Boyd will return to the track in the 100m preliminary round.
